Slope stabilization on the sandy bluffs takes precision. Sandy soil has little cohesion, so a steep bluff face above Chambers Bay or the Sound can slump and erode, especially when winter rain saturates it. We stabilize these slopes with engineered retaining structures, proper drainage to relieve the water pressure, and careful grading that respects the sensitive coastal setting. Getting the drainage right is central, since it is saturation that turns stable sand into a moving slope.

Base containment on fast-draining Sunset Terrace soils

The gravelly, sandy soils across Sunset Terrace and toward Chambers Creek drain quickly, which is good for moisture but means a paver base needs containment so the aggregate doesn't migrate into the loose surrounding soil. We use geotextile separation and firm edge restraint to hold the base together, keeping patios and walks flat over the long term. Near the Curran Apple Orchard this containment is what makes hardscape last on ground that would otherwise let the base spread and settle. Building the base to stay put on University Place's fast-draining soils is the specific detail that separates durable hardscape here from installations that gradually sink.
